Output 3a8f150024d262113476b040b30a477651dfb53dac114126aed6c8e9da3ad1dd:0

value
15086549
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c4d041ab97b26d9fd2bb60a756872d4f0da822a OP_EQUALVERIFY OP_CHECKSIG
address
19R3RpLbJzrz1KKH7YhzNGh26GKzQwtM3o
transaction
3a8f150024d262113476b040b30a477651dfb53dac114126aed6c8e9da3ad1dd
confirmations
611974
spent
true